首页
/ 【亲测免费】 探索C上位机开发的宝藏:一份值得收藏的源码

【亲测免费】 探索C上位机开发的宝藏:一份值得收藏的源码

2026-01-25 04:31:24作者:董斯意

项目介绍

在现代工业自动化和嵌入式系统开发中,上位机软件扮演着至关重要的角色。它不仅负责与硬件设备进行通信,还承担着数据处理、用户界面展示等多重任务。为了帮助开发者快速入门并深入理解C#上位机开发,我们推出了一份基于C#的上位机源码,专为VS2013平台设计。这份源码不仅代码可靠,而且注释详尽,非常适合初学者和有经验的开发者参考和学习。

项目技术分析

开发环境

  • IDE:Visual Studio 2013
  • 编程语言:C#

技术栈

  • Windows Forms:用于构建用户界面,提供直观的图形化操作体验。
  • 串口通信:实现上位机与下位机之间的数据传输,确保通信的稳定性和可靠性。
  • 多线程处理:优化数据处理和界面响应,提升用户体验。

代码结构

  • 模块化设计:代码按照功能模块进行划分,便于维护和扩展。
  • 注释详尽:每段代码都附有详细的注释,帮助开发者快速理解代码逻辑。

项目及技术应用场景

应用场景

  • 工业自动化:用于监控和控制生产线上的设备,实现自动化生产。
  • 嵌入式系统:作为嵌入式系统的上位机软件,负责数据采集和处理。
  • 实验室设备:用于控制和监测实验室设备,进行数据分析和记录。

技术优势

  • 跨平台兼容性:虽然基于VS2013开发,但C#语言的跨平台特性使得代码可以在不同版本的Visual Studio中运行。
  • 易于扩展:模块化的设计使得开发者可以根据需求轻松添加新功能。
  • 学习资源丰富:详细的注释和清晰的代码结构,为初学者提供了宝贵的学习资源。

项目特点

1. 代码可靠性

经过严格测试,代码运行稳定,确保开发者可以放心使用。

2. 学习价值高

对于初学者来说,这份源码不仅是学习C#编程的好材料,更是理解上位机开发流程的绝佳案例。

3. 注释详尽

代码中的每一步操作都有详细的注释,帮助开发者快速上手,减少学习曲线。

4. 开源社区支持

项目采用MIT许可证,欢迎开发者贡献代码,共同完善项目。

结语

这份基于C#的上位机源码不仅是一份实用的开发工具,更是一份宝贵的学习资源。无论你是初学者还是有经验的开发者,都能从中受益。赶快下载源码,开启你的C#上位机开发之旅吧!

登录后查看全文
热门项目推荐
相关项目推荐